Why Energy Storage Tests Like Bloemfontein Matter
Imagine living in a world where solar farms work through the night and wind turbines power cities during calm days. That's exactly what battery energy storage systems (BESS) promise. The Bloemfontein Battery Energy Storage Test serves as a critical benchmark for grid-scale energy storage, particularly in regions with high renewable energy penetration.

Key Findings from the Bloemfontein Project
Recent data reveals impressive performance metrics:
| Metric | Result | Industry Average |
|---|---|---|
| Round-Trip Efficiency | 92.4% | 88-90% |
| Response Time | <0.5 seconds | 2-5 seconds |
| Cycle Life | 8,200 cycles | 6,000 cycles |
These numbers aren't just statistics – they translate to real benefits for energy providers and consumers. For instance, the improved cycle life means systems last 30% longer than conventional solutions.

The Future of Energy Storage Technology
Emerging trends spotted during the Bloemfontein test:
- AI-driven battery management systems
- Modular designs enabling scalable solutions
- Hybrid systems combining lithium-ion and flow batteries
Fun fact: The test facility uses recycled battery packs for 15% of its storage capacity – a circular economy approach gaining traction worldwide.
